Nomura is an investment banking and securities firm that serve the needs of individuals, institutions, corporate and governments.
Nomura is a financial services group and global investment bank. Based in Tokyo and with regional headquarters in Hong Kong, London, and New York, Nomura employs about 26,000 staff worldwide. It operates through five business divisions: retail (in Japan), global markets, investment banking, merchant banking, and asset management.
Nomura with a nationwide network of branch offices, call centers and Internet services, the company continues to provide world-class products and services centered on consulting-based sales, and implement a series of strategic initiatives to ensure we remain a trusted partner to its clients.
Asset Management achieves stable and sustainable growth as an asset management company that is trusted by investors around the world and will contribute to an increase in earnings by expanding the client franchise of the Nomura Group.
